LAIR-1 triggering inhibits T cell effector functions. A Pan T cells were isolated from spleen and stimulated with indicated concentrations of immobilized anti-CD3 (clone 145-2C11), in the presence of an isotype control (blue) or an agonistic LAIR-1 antibody (clone 113, red) and proliferation was assessed after 3 days by flow cytometry for both CD4+ (left) and CD8+ (right) T cells. B As in (A), but activation status of T cells, as determined by CD25 and CD69 surface expression, was assessed by flow cytometry. C Supernatant of cultures as in (A) was harvested and cytokine production of T cell cultures was assessed by ELISA. Graphs depict three mice from one representative experiment. Statistical significance was assessed by two-way ANOVA, for Granzyme B significance is indicated for overall effect of LAIR-1 ligation. P values below 0.1 are depicted
